gist

IPA: /dʒɪst/

KK: /dʒɪst/

noun

Definition: The main idea or essence of something, often summarizing the most important points.

Example: The gist of the article was about the importance of environmental conservation.

give

IPA: /ɡɪv/

KK: /gɪv/

intransitive verb

Definition: To allow something to happen or to provide access; to yield or collapse under pressure; to make a donation or gift.

Example: The roof gave under the weight of the snow.

noun

Definition: The ability of a material or object to bend or compress without breaking, often described as springiness or resilience.

Example: The give of the rubber band allows it to stretch without snapping.

given

IPA: /ˈɡɪvən/

KK: /ˈgɪvən/

adjective

Definition: Describing something that is specified, assumed, or presented as a gift; often used to indicate a particular condition or tendency.

Example: Given the weather, we should bring an umbrella.

noun

Definition: Something that is accepted as true or certain without proof; often considered a basic condition or assumption.

Example: In mathematics, we often start with a few givens to build our proofs.

preposition

Definition: In consideration of something; taking into account.

Example: Given the circumstances, we should proceed with caution.

verb

Definition: To provide or hand over something to someone.

Example: She has given her time to help others in need.

giving

IPA: /ˈɡɪvɪŋ/

KK: /ˈgɪvɪŋ/

adjective

Definition: Having the tendency to provide or share something with others.

Example: She is known for her giving nature, always helping those in need.

verb

Definition: To provide someone with something or to hand over something to someone.

Example: She is giving her friend a gift for her birthday.

glabella

IPA: /ɡləˈbɛlə/

KK: /gləˈbɛlə/

noun

Definition: The smooth area of skin located between the eyebrows, just above the nose.

Example: The doctor examined the glabella for any signs of swelling.

glabellar

IPA: /ɡləˈbɛl.ər/

KK: /gləˈbɛl.ər/

adjective

Definition: Relating to the glabella, which is the smooth part of the forehead above the nose.

Example: The doctor examined the glabellar region for any signs of swelling.

glace

IPA: //ɡleɪs//

KK: /gleɪs/

adjective

Definition: Describing something that has a smooth and shiny surface, often due to a coating or finish.

Example: The cake was beautifully decorated with a glace icing that shimmered in the light.

glacial

IPA: /ˈɡleɪʃəl/

KK: /ˈɡleɪʃəl/

adjective

Definition: Relating to glaciers or very cold temperatures; can also describe a cold or unfriendly demeanor.

Example: The glacial winds made it difficult to enjoy the outdoor event.

glacially

IPA: /ˈɡleɪʃəli/

KK: /ˈɡleɪʃəli/

adverb

Definition: In a manner that is very slow or cold, similar to the movement of glaciers.

Example: The project progressed glacially, taking much longer than expected.

glaciate

IPA: /ˈɡleɪʃieɪt/

KK: /ˈɡleɪʃieɪt/

transitive verb

Definition: To cover something with ice or to make it icy, often referring to the process of glaciers forming or moving.

Example: The scientists studied how the mountains would glaciate over the next century due to climate change.
